Distt admin Ganderbal holds public outreach program at Tulbagh Sherpathri

GANDERBAL, MARCH 07: In a continued effort to enhance public engagement and address local issues at the grassroots level, the Deputy Commissioner (DC) Ganderbal, Jatin Kishore, today convened a public outreach program at Tulbagh Sherpathri.

The program was also attended by the District Development Council (DDC) Vice-Chairperson, Bilal Ahmad, along with other senior officials, to listen to public grievances and ensure effective governance.

During the event, residents of Block Sherpathri actively participated, voicing their concerns and developmental needs, including proper garbage disposal, construction of a playground in Hatbara, desilting of Qazi Canal, repair of streetlights, installation of distribution transformers, cutting of poplar trees at Middle School Sehpora, establishment of fire service station, bank branch at Shallabugh, and construction of bridge at Rabitar.

The locals sought the intervention of the Deputy Commissioner for the timely resolution of these issues.

Addressing the gathering, the DC reaffirmed the administration’s commitment to reaching out to remote areas and ensuring responsive and inclusive governance. He assured the locals that all genuine concerns raised during the program would be duly examined, and necessary steps would be taken for their redressal.

Regarding waste management, the Block Development Officer (BDO) Sherpathri informed that garbage collection has been outsourced, and the contractor has already begun waste collection in Shallabugh village.

Additionally, the Assistant Commissioner Development (ACD) was asked to prepare a comprehensive desilting plan in consultation with the irrigation department for inclusion in the new development plan.

The outreach program was attended by Additional Deputy Commissioner Ganderbal, Gulzar Ahmad; Program Officer ICDS, GM DIC, CPO, ACD, ACP, and other district and sectoral officers.
